Ibi Ndụ Dị Ka Ndị Mbilite n'Ọnwụ 

Ibi ndụ dịka mbilite n'ọnwụ ndị mmadụ abụghị naanị echiche okpukpe anyị na-eme emume otu ugboro n'afọ; ọ bụ eziokwu doro anya nke otu anyị si eche echiche, duzie, jee ozi, na ije ije kwa ụbọchị. Mbilite n'ọnwụ nke Jizọs abụghị naanị ihe akaebe nke ndụ mgbe ọnwụ gasịrị, ọ bụ ọkwa nke ụdị ndụ ọhụrụ tupu ọnwụ. Mgbe Pọl dere, sị, "Ebe ọ bụ na e bilitela unu na Kraịst, tinye obi unu n'ihe ndị dị n'elu" (Ndị Kọlọsi 3:1), ọ naghị ekwu okwu n'ụzọ ihe atụ kama ọ na-ekwu ihe n'ezie. Ndị mmadụ bi n'ọnwụ bi site n'ebe dị iche. A naghị egosipụta njirimara anyị site n'egwu, ụkọ, ma ọ bụ ndakpọ olileanya, kama site na mmeri nke Kraịst. Ili tọgbọ chakoo na-agbanwe ihe niile. Ọdịda abụghịzi ihe ikpeazụ, adịghị ike anaghịzi akpata ntaramahụhụ, ọchịchịrị adịghịkwa adịte aka.


Ịdị ndụ dịka mbilite n'ọnwụ ndị mmadụ pụtara na anyị na-ebu olileanya gaa n'ebe nkịtị. Anyị na-abanye n'ebe ọrụ, ezinụlọ, na obodo ọ bụghị dị ka ndị na-agbalị ịlanarị, kama dị ka ndị e guzobere na mmeri. Pita na-echetara anyị na "O nyela anyị ọmụmụ ọhụrụ ka anyị bụrụ olileanya dị ndụ site na mbilite n'ọnwụ nke Jizọs Kraịst site na ndị nwụrụ anwụ" (1 Pita 1:3). Olileanya a bụ ndụ n'ihi na Kraịst dị ndụ. Ọ na-eku ume n'ime nkụda mmụọ, na-ekwu okwu n'ime obi abụọ, ma na-eme ka anyị guzosie ike mgbe ọnọdụ yiri ka ọ gaghị ekwe omume ịkwaga. Ndụ mbilite n'ọnwụ anaghị ada ụda ma ọ bụ dị egwu ọtụtụ oge; ọ na-abụkarị ntachi obi dị jụụ, okwukwe ndidi, na ịhụnanya siri ike mgbe ndị ọzọ ga-ada mbà.

Ndị mmadụ na-ebikwa ndụ dị iche n'otú ha si azaghachi ndị ọzọ. N'ihi na anyị enwetala ndụ, anyị na-aghọ ndị na-enye ndụ. Anyị na-agbaghara ndị ọzọ ngwa ngwa, na-agba ume karịa n'uche, ma na-eje ozi karịa n'obi. Pọl dere, sị, "Ya mere, e liri anyị na ya site na baptism baa n'ọnwụ ka anyị wee, dịka e si kpọlite ​​Kraịst n'ọnwụ... anyị onwe anyị wee bie ndụ ọhụrụ" (Ndị Rom 6:4). Ndụ ọhụrụ ahụ na-apụta ìhè n'àgwà gbanwere agbanwe. Ilu na-enye ohere maka amara. Nchegbu na-enye ụzọ maka ntụkwasị obi. Nchebe onwe onye na-enye ụzọ maka mmesapụ aka. Mbilite n'ọnwụ na-agbanwe mmụọ anyị. Anyị na-amalite igosipụta àgwà nke Kraịst ahụ e bilitere n'ọnwụ na mmekọrịta kwa ụbọchị.

E nwekwara obi ike na ndụ mbilite n'ọnwụ. Ndị na-eso ụzọ mbụ si n'ime ụlọ kpọchiri akpọchi gaa n'ịgba àmà n'ihu ọha n'ihi na ha zutere Onyenwe anyị e bilitere n'ọnwụ. Otu Mmụọ ahụ nke kpọlitere Jizọs na-enye ndị kwere ekwe ike ugbu a. Pọl kwupụtara, sị, “Achọrọ m ịmara Kraịst—ee, ịmara ike nke mbilite n’ọnwụ ya” (Ndị Filipaị 3:10). Ike ahụ abụghị naanị ọrụ ebube, kama ọ bụ ike ịnọgidesi ike, obi ike ikwu eziokwu, na ịdị umeala n’obi ijere ndị ọzọ ozi. Ndị nwụrụ anwụ abụghị ndị na-enweghị egwu n’ihi na ndụ dị mfe, kama n’ihi na Kraịst dị ndụ.

Ịdị ndụ dị ka mbilite n’ọnwụ na-agbanwekwa otú anyị si ahụ ọdịnihu. Anyị anaghị agagharị n’enweghị nzube ma ọ bụ nwee nkụda mmụọ n’ọnọdụ ụwa. Anyị na-ebi ndụ na atụmanya siri ike. Mbilite n’ọnwụ bụ mkpụrụ mbụ, mmalite nke ime ka ihe niile dị ọhụrụ nke Chineke. N’ihi na Jizọs dị ndụ, anyị na-etinye ego n’ihe dị mkpa. Anyị na-ewulite obodo, na-achụso ikpe ziri ezi, na-ekerịta ozi ọma, ma na-ahụ n’anya n’àjà, na-ama na ọ dịghị ihe ọ bụla e mere n’ime Kraịst efuola. Dịka Pọl si mechie, “Guzosie ike. Ekwela ka ihe ọ bụla kpalie unu. Na-enye onwe unu n’ọrụ Onyenwe anyị mgbe niile, n’ihi na unu maara na ọrụ unu n’ime Onyenwe anyị abụghị ihe efu” (1 Ndị Kọrịnt 15:58).

Dịka Ndị Kraịst, ibi ndụ dị ka mbilite n’ọnwụ pụtara ịbụ ndị e ji olileanya, okwukwe, na ịhụnanya mara. Ọ pụtara ikpe ekpere n’atụmanya, ije ozi n’ọmịiko, na ịnabata ndị ọzọ n’amara. Ọ pụtara ikwere na Chineke ka na-eweta ndụ ebe e nwere mfu, ọṅụ ebe e nwere ihe isi ike, na nzube ebe e nwere ihe a na-amaghị ama. Mbilite n'ọnwụ abụghị naanị ihe anyị na-akpọsa; ọ bụ ihe anyị na-egosipụta. Anyị na-ebi ndụ dị iche iche n'ihi na a kpọlitela Kraịst n'ọnwụ. Anyị na-eje ozi dị iche iche n'ihi na Kraịst dị ndụ. Anyị na-atụ anya n'ụzọ dị iche n'ihi na ili tọgbọ chakoo, Jizọs ahụ bilitere n'ọnwụ ka na-esokwa anyị na-eje ije.

Planning your Visit

Welcome to Runnymede Christian Fellowship, an Egham Church


studentwelcomer 

Runnymede Christian Fellowship is a church based in Egham but serving a much larger geographical area. Those who call us home come from EghamVirginia Water, Staines, Englefield Green, Egham Hythe, Pooley Green, Maidenhead, Heathrow, Slough, Ashford, Thorpe, Windsor, Woking and beyond.

Our church is a community of believers who gather regularly to share life and demonstrate God's love. We do this by encouraging and serving each other and the community. We believe in the power of prayer and are always happy to pray for you.
 

Church - What to expect

Our Sunday service is available to stream online at 11:00 a.m. You can join us on Livestream or via Facebook, LinkedIn, YouTube or X (Twitter).

The Sunday Service is now held at Strodes College, Strodes College Lane in Egham open to all, so if you would like to join us, please feel free to do so. If you have any questions, please call us on 01784 637010.

We run a physical Sunday School most weeks. If you would like your children to receive a weekly Sunday School teaching pack that you can do from home, please email us at admin@e-runnymede.co.uk so that we can send you the materials.
 

Church on Sunday at Strodes College, Egham


 Prophetic word for students -

Our Sunday service starts at 11:00 a.m. and typically lasts about 90 minutes.

We begin each service with lively worship, featuring songs from around the world, followed by inspiring, Bible-based teaching. All our sermons are recorded and are available as a podcast after the service.

We have a monthly cycle of Sunday services, with our Communion Service being on the first Sunday of each month and an All-Age All-Nation Service on the second Sunday of each month. Our other Sunday services include Spirit-focused and teaching services.

We have consciously adopted being a blended church, that is, both online and face-to-face. You are welcome to join us on Livestream or via Facebook, LinkedIn, YouTube, or X (Twitter), or you can catch up and watch the recordings later.
 

Joining us in person

Visiting a new and unfamiliar church for the first time can be intimidating, but we want to ensure you feel welcome and enjoy your time with us. A friendly face will be waiting to meet you at the entrance and welcome you. 

Doors open at 10:30 a.m. for coffee and prayer. Our Sunday Service starts at 11:00 a.m. and typically runs for about 90 minutes, normally followed by tea and coffee.
 

Driving and Car Parking

Our Sunday Morning Service is now held at Strodes College, Strodes College Lane, Egham, TW20 9DR, which has ample parking. Click on the link for directions to RCF.

We have plenty of parking spaces right outside the building. Spaces are reserved near the entrance for anyone with mobility issues (those with a blue badge). Please let us know if you need to use one of these spaces, have any special needs, or require any assistance.

The car parking area is a public area, so please ensure that your children are under your control and that, for their safety, they do not run around in the car park.
 

Visiting with children?

Everyone is welcome at RCF. We encourage everyone, regardless of age, to join the service. We offer Sunday School, which begins after worship and runs concurrently with the sermon for 30 to 40 minutes, serving children aged 4 to 12. On the second Sunday of each month, we have a shorter All-Aged All Nations Service, where the children stay for the worship and the sermon.
